Two killed in separate Surkhet road accidents



SURKHET: Two people including a ward secretary died in a road accident in Surkhet.

The deceased has been identified as Narayan Giri of municipality-2. Giri, who was riding a motorbike, was hit by an auto rickshaw at Arichok in Birendranagar.

Police have taken auto rickshaw driver Deepak Saud under control.

Similarly, driver Ram Bahadur Nepali died after his tractor turned turtle at Girighat on Bangesimal-Baddichaur road section.
